Choosing the right extended snorkeling gear involves considering several factors such as water temperature, fit, and personal snorkeling style. Gear that excels in thermal protection and durability is crucial for cooler waters, where extended exposure can otherwise lead to discomfort. A good fit is essential, as it prevents water from entering the snorkel or mask, thus ensuring that your underwater experience is as uninterrupted as possible. Moreover, for those who snorkel frequently or engage in long sessions, gear that prioritizes comfort, such as masks with soft silicone seals and snorkels with efficient purge valves, can make a substantial difference in their overall sea adventure.
